The Key Characteristics of Latina Makeup
Latina makeup is celebrated for its boldness, vibrancy, and deep connection to cultural heritage. Below are the key characteristics that define this beautiful and unique makeup style:
1. Flawless, Glowing Skin
A radiant complexion is the foundation of Latina makeup. Achieving a healthy, glowing base is often a priority, with many tutorials emphasizing the importance of skincare as a prerequisite. Dewy finishes using hydrating products, luminous foundations, and highlighters are essential, ensuring the skin looks fresh and natural, while still providing full coverage.
2. Bold, Statement Lip Colors
Latina makeup often centers around striking lip shades. Classic reds, deep burgundies, mauves, and bright coral hues are staples, chosen to complement a wide range of skin tones. Lip liners play a key role in achieving precise, defined lips, a hallmark of this makeup style.
3. Defined Brows
Well-defined, full brows are a signature of Latina beauty. They are often shaped to perfection with either pomades or pencils to enhance their natural appearance. A focus on bold, arched brows frames the face and accentuates the eyes.
4. Dramatic Eye Looks
Eye makeup is often bold and expressive, featuring sultry, well-blended smoky eyes or vibrant pops of color. Eyeliners and mascaras are used generously to enhance the lashes and create captivating looks, while shimmery or metallic eyeshadows add depth and drama.
5. Expert Use of Contouring and Highlighting
Latina makeup incorporates expert techniques in contouring and highlighting to sculpt the face and enhance its natural angles. These techniques add depth, dimension, and a touch of glamour.
6. Cultural References and Personalization
A unique aspect of Latina makeup is its connection to heritage. Traditional beauty practices often inspire current trends, blending timeless techniques with modern products. This allows for personalized, culturally rich makeup looks that resonate with individuality and pride.

Essential Makeup Products for Latina Looks
Achieving iconic Latina beauty looks often involves a blend of expressive colors, glowing skin, and bold features. Here’s a detailed guide to essential makeup products that can help you recreate these stunning styles:
- Flawless Base with Foundation and Concealer – A smooth and radiant complexion is the foundation of any Latina-inspired look. Look for foundations that provide medium to full coverage with a dewy or natural finish to emulate that vibrant glow. Use a concealer to expertly cover blemishes or dark spots, and brighten areas like under the eyes and the chin for a lifted appearance.
- Brow Perfection with Eyebrow Pomade or Pencils – Defined eyebrows are a hallmark of Latina beauty. They frame the face and emphasize your natural features. A good-quality brow pomade or pencil allows you to sculpt and shape your brows precisely while maintaining a natural yet bold look.
- Vivid Eyeshadow Palettes – Latina beauty embraces vibrant and warm-toned eyeshadows. Opt for palettes with shades like golds, bronzes, fiery oranges, and deep browns. These colors complement a wide variety of skin tones and add depth and allure to the eyes. You can also experiment with bold pigments to create dramatic looks for special occasions.
- Volumizing Mascara and Eyeliner – Eyes are often a focal point in Latina-inspired makeup. A volumizing mascara is essential to create long, luscious lashes that open up the eyes. Pair this with liquid eyeliner for precise winged lines or a pencil liner for a softer, smudged effect. Black or dark brown shades are classic, but you can also try colorful liners to explore playful styles.
- Bold Lip Colors – Classic latina-inspired looks often feature bold and statement lips. Rich red, burgundy, and deep mauve hues are staples for instantly elevating your makeup. For a sophisticated look, matte lipsticks offer a modern edge, while glossy finishes add a touch of youthful vibrancy.
- Illuminating Highlighter – Latina beauty is synonymous with glowing skin, and highlighters play a key role in achieving this effect. Choose shades that suit your skin tone—champagne, gold, or rose gold hues work wonderfully. Apply highlighter to the tops of your cheekbones, the bridge of your nose, and the inner corners of your eyes for a radiant finish.
- Blush for a Natural Flush – A pop of blush can bring life to your cheeks and give a healthy-looking flush. Shades like peach, coral, and soft pinks add warmth and dimension, blending perfectly with bronzed or sun-kissed skin tones.
- Setting Products for Long-Lasting Wear – Humidity and long days require makeup to stay in place. A good setting powder can lock your base makeup, while a setting spray ensures a dewy or matte finish, depending on your preference. Both are critical for keeping the look polished and fresh all day long.

Step-by-Step Guide to Latina Makeup Tutorials
Latina makeup tutorials are a fantastic way to explore bold, vibrant, and flawless beauty looks that celebrate cultural richness and diversity. Whether you’re aiming for a natural daytime glow or a glamorous evening vibe, step-by-step guidance can help you achieve the perfect Latina-inspired makeup style. This guide will take you through all the essential steps to master the art of Latina makeup.
Step 1: Prepping Your Skin
Preparing your skin ensures a smooth canvas for makeup application and longevity for your finished look.
Cleansing and Moisturizing
Start by thoroughly cleansing your face to remove any dirt, oil, or residue. Follow with a moisturizer that suits your skin type to hydrate your skin and ensure a flawless application. Hydrated skin allows the makeup to glide on effortlessly and avoids a cakey appearance.
Choosing the Right Primer
A primer is indispensable for Latina makeup tutorials as it creates a barrier between your skin and makeup while ensuring a flawless base. Depending on your skin needs, choose a mattifying primer for oily skin or radiance-boosting primers for a dewy finish.
Step 2: Perfecting the Base
The base is critical in achieving a polished look.
Selecting the Right Foundation Shade
Matching your foundation to your skin tone and undertone is key to an even and natural finish. Latina skin tones are diverse, so look for foundations with warm or golden undertones for accurate results. Blend the foundation well to avoid streaks or uneven spots.
Highlighting and Contouring for Dimension
Highlighting and contouring are essential steps in Latina makeup tutorials for achieving that sculpted and glowing look. Use a highlighter one or two shades lighter than your skin tone for the high points of your face and pair it with a contour shade slightly darker to add depth and dimension.
Setting the Base for All-Day Wear
Lock your base in place with a translucent setting powder to avoid creases and oiliness. For a longer-lasting finish, spritz your face with a setting spray that matches your desired look—matte for day looks, dewy for night glam.
Step 3: Conceal and Highlight
Concealing is vital for hiding imperfections like dark circles or blemishes. Choose a concealer one or two shades lighter than your foundation to brighten your under-eye area and highlight the high points of your face. Dab and blend gently with a sponge or brush to achieve a seamless finish.
Step 4: Contour Brush and Powder
Using a contour brush and powder tailored to your skin tone, sculpt your cheekbones, jawline, and forehead for definition. The key is blending to avoid harsh lines. Latina makeup tutorials often emphasize a soft yet striking contour for added drama.
Step 5: Enhancing the Eyes
Eyes are an essential focus of Latina makeup. Bold, defined eyes can transform your look entirely.
Filling and Shaping Bold Brows
Latina-inspired makeup highlights the beauty of bold, well-shaped brows. Use a brow pencil or pomade to fill in sparse areas, following the natural arch of your brows. Keep the look natural but defined to frame your face.
Applying Eyeshadow for a Dramatic Effect
Choose eyeshadow shades that complement your outfit and occasion. Warm tones like gold, bronze, and red are popular in Latina makeup tutorials. Blend the shadow seamlessly for a professional finish.
Mastering Winged Eyeliner
The iconic winged eyeliner is a must-have for Latina makeup looks. Use a liquid or gel eyeliner for precision and create a sharp, defined wing that enhances your eye shape.
Adding Volume with False Lashes or Mascara
Complete your eye look with fluttery, voluminous lashes. Apply false lashes for a dramatic effect, or layer mascara for an equally striking result.
Step 6: Bringing in the Glow
Glow is the hallmark of a radiant Latina makeup look.
Choosing the Correct Blush Shade
A warm-toned blush, such as coral or peach, complements most Latina skin tones. Apply blush to the apples of your cheeks and blend upward for a lifted and youthful effect.
Highlighting for Radiance
Highlighting adds that extra glow to your skin. Apply a shimmering highlighter to the high points of your face—cheekbones, nose bridge, and brow bones—for a radiant finish. Latina makeup tutorials often emphasize this step to achieve a sun-kissed look.
Step 7: Finishing with Lips
Lips can make or break your entire makeup look, as they act as the finishing touch that ties everything together. The right lip color or finish can elevate your style, while neglecting them can leave your makeup feeling incomplete.
Choosing Bold or Neutral Colors
Bright red, berry, and burgundy shades are a staple in Latina makeup tutorials for bold statements, while nude or pink shades are perfect for a softer, natural vibe.
Creating a Long-Lasting Lip Look
To ensure your lip color lasts all day, start with a lip liner that matches your lipstick. Fill in your lips completely with the liner before applying your lipstick. Finish with a touch of gloss for a plump and luscious finish.
Step 8: Tons of Highlighter Glow
Finally, complete your Latina makeup look with an abundance of highlighter. Apply it generously to your cheekbones, nose, and collarbones for an ethereal glow. This finishing touch embodies the elegance and vibrant charm of Latina makeup aesthetics.

What is the difference between Indian makeup and Korean makeup?
Indian makeup often focuses on bold, vibrant colors, dramatic eyes with kohl and eyeliner, and a heavier overall appearance. Korean makeup, on the other hand, emphasizes a natural, minimalist look, with glowing “glass skin,” soft blush, gradient lips, and understated eye makeup. Both styles cater to their respective cultural beauty ideals and preferences.

What is dirty girl makeup?
Dirty girl makeup refers to a grunge-inspired, undone approach to makeup. It often includes smudged eyeliner, smoky eyes, slightly messy brows, and neutral to dark lips, aiming for an effortless and rebellious aesthetic.
